The Cost of Senior Care
When looking at the cost of Senior care there is no inexpensive option, but In Home Care can be the best value. The senior care options price breakdown as follows Care Type In-Home Care Nursing Homes (semi-private) Nursing Homes (private) Assisted Living (private) Hourly Rate $22-$25/hour N/A N/A N/A Daily Rate $100-500/day** $181-250/day $205-350/day $120/day** […]
24/7 Care Vs. Live-In Care
Many people ask me “what is the difference between 24/7 care and Live-in care?” There is a large cost difference and it is important to know your options. 24/7 care is provided for people that need care and monitoring 24 hours per day.
